Substance abuse does not always lead to addiction, but when it does, the results could be life changing and deadly. Addiction can be a very difficult thing to overcome, but it is in no way impossible. Many people want to change but often don’t know the best way to go about starting the process.  Often times, they wonder what is the best treatment option.

Commonly used methods of treatment are inpatient rehab and outpatient rehab. Both of these are viable options when it comes to getting treatment for a substance abuse addiction. Despite this, though outpatient rehab may be helpful and effective for some, even if the addiction is only moderate, it might not be enough to fully kick the addiction. This is where inpatient rehab becomes the next step.

Residential treatment is an intensive, rigorous, inpatient program that places the patient in an immersive and completely safe space. It may involve being in a hospital setting or a non-hospital setting depending on the individual’s needs. Often times, people believe that detoxification is enough but usually it should be followed by a residential treatment.

Residential treatment centers come with many perks and benefits that aren’t included in outpatient programs. This includes:

  • Sleeping accommodations, meals, and daily essentials
  • In house counseling, education, and therapies
  • Zero distractions and temptations
  • Close monitoring and comprehensive care
  • Structured days and recreational activities
  • Highly trained professionals who are there to help and provide guidance

Residential treatments are ideal for people who have tried other methods but have not yielded the desired results. They get to fully focus on beating addiction, all while learning strategic, positive affirmations along the way to help them better cope once they leave. It is a long lasting method that is proven to work. If you have tried in the past and now you want to successful results in a positive environment then this kind of treatment may be for you.
